China’s state media has reported the country’s foreign minister Qin Gang has been removed from office.
The 57-year-old has not made public appearances for the last month – prompting speculation about his position.
The foreign ministry previously cited health reasons for Mr Qin’s absence, during which time China’s top diplomat took on many of the foreign minister’s duties.
